Here's a quick rundown of the roles featured in the chart: 1. **Robotics Engineer**: As a robotic engineer, you'll focus on designing, creating, and maintaining robots. This role typically requires a strong background in mechanical, electrical, and software engineering. 2. **Automation Specialist**: Automation specialists are responsible for implementing and managing automated systems, improving efficiency and reducing human error in various industries. 3. **Robotics Technician**: As a technician, you'll install, maintain, and repair robotic systems, ensuring optimal performance and addressing any technical issues. 4. **Data Scientist (Robotics Focus)**: Data scientists use machine learning algorithms, statistical models, and data visualization techniques to extract insights from large datasets. In the context of robotics, these professionals focus on applications related to robotic systems and their integration with AI. 5. **Robotics Software Developer**: Software developers in robotics create, test, and maintain software for robots, enabling them to perform complex tasks and interact with their environment.
